世界のHVDC/HVAC電力ケーブル敷設船の市場規模は、2022年の11億7,860万米ドル、2023年の12億4,650万米ドルから、予測期間中は8.91%のCAGRで推移し、2032年には21億6,470万米ドルの規模に成長すると予測されています。
HVDC/HVAC電力ケーブル敷設船市場には、海底電力ケーブルの敷設と修理に特化した船が含まれます。これらの船舶は、オフショア再生可能エネルギープロジェクト、特にオフショア風力発電所の開発や、遠隔地の電源と陸上システムとの接続に不可欠です。これらの船舶は、正確で効率的なケーブル敷設を可能にするため、ダイナミックポジショニングシステム、ケーブルハンドリング装置、海底トレンチシステムなどの最先端技術を装備しています。国内外を問わず、長距離の送電を確実かつ効率的に行う上で重要な役割を担っています。

The HVDC/HVAC Power Cable Laying Vessel Market was valued at USD 1,178.6 million in 2022. The HVDC/HVAC Power Cable Laying Vessel Market is expected to increase from USD 1,246.5 million in 2023 to USD 2,164.7 million by 2032, with a compound yearly growth rate (CAGR) of 8.91% throughout the forecast period (2024-2032).
The HVDC/HVAC power cable laying vessel market includes specialized vessels for installing and repairing underwater power cables. These vessels are critical to the development of offshore renewable energy projects, particularly offshore wind farms, as well as linking remote power sources to onshore systems. These vessels are outfitted with cutting-edge technology, including dynamic positioning systems, cable handling equipment, and subsea trenching systems, to enable accurate and efficient cable installation. They serve an important role in ensuring the reliable and efficient transmission of power over great distances, both domestically and globally.

Regional insights
The HVDC/HVAC Power Cable Laying Vessel market is divided into five regions: North America, Europe, Asia Pacific, the Middle East and Africa, and Latin America. The Asia-Pacific HVDC/HVAC Power Cable Laying Vessel market has the largest market share and is predicted to account for a sizable revenue share throughout the forecast period. The Asia Pacific area is emerging as a major player in the HVDC and HVAC power cable laying vessel markets, driven by fast industrialization, urbanization, and rising energy demand. Countries such as China, Japan, and India are making significant investments in renewable energy projects, such as offshore wind and solar systems, demanding improved cable laying technologies to support these advances. The region's extensive coastline and offshore resources provide unique prospects for cable laying operations, increasing demand for specialist vessels. Furthermore, government regulations aimed at increasing energy efficiency and lowering reliance on fossil fuels are driving investment in infrastructure, including HVDC systems.
Key players in the HVDC/HVAC Power Cable Laying Vessel Market include Prysmian Group, Nexans, NKT A/S, Seway7, Van Oord, Boskalis, Taihan Cable & Solution, Global Marine Group, DeepOcean, ASEAN Cableship, OMS Group Sdn Bhd, ZTT Group, LS Cable & System Ltd., Orient Cable (NBO), and others.
